Lincoln Owner Credit Card Review

This is a store card issued by Citi®. If you're wondering whether Lincoln Owner Credit Card is the right card for you, read on.

Key Takeaways

  • High APRs. This is not a great card for people who carry a balance. It has a variable purchase APR of 28.49%
  • No annual fee. This is a great option for people looking for a low-maintenance card. It gives you the benefits of a credit card, but you don't have to pay an annual fee for the privilege.
  • Fair or better credit required. You will have good approval odds if your credit score is above 600.

What are the relevant APRs for Lincoln Owner Credit Card?

According to the Federal Reserve Board, the average regular APR is 15% for all credit cards and 17% for accounts that carry a balance. This card has higher than average regular APRs.

Lincoln Owner Credit Card has a variable purchase APR of 28.49%.
